Understanding the Orthopedic Surgical Equipment Market Landscape

The orthopedic surgical equipment sector encompasses a broad range of products designed to diagnose, treat, and rehabilitate musculoskeletal conditions. From traditional surgical instruments to cutting-edge robotics-assisted devices, the market is characterized by innovation and high demand.

Market Size and Growth Trends

According to recent industry reports, the orthopedic surgical equipment market is projected to grow at a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of approximately 5-7% over the next five years. Factors fueling this growth include:

  • Demographic Shifts: Increasing aging populations worldwide, leading to a higher incidence of osteoporosis, arthritis, and joint degeneration.
  • Technological Advancements: Incorporation of minimally invasive techniques, robotics, and 3D printing in surgical procedures.
  • Rising Healthcare Expenditure: Governments and private sectors investing more in orthopedic healthcare infrastructure.
  • Awareness and Early Intervention: Improved diagnostic tools and preventive measures encouraging early surgical interventions.

Key Market Segments

The market can be segmented based on product types, end-users, and geographic regions:

  1. Product Types: Orthopedic implants, surgical instruments, navigation systems, fixation devices, and robotic surgical equipment.
  2. End-Users: Hospitals, orthopedic clinics, ambulatory surgical centers, and research institutions.
  3. Geographical Regions: North America, Europe, Asia-Pacific, and emerging markets in Latin America and Africa.

Critical Components of Successful Businesses in Orthopedic Surgical Equipment

To thrive in this competitive landscape, businesses need to focus on various core factors that influence success and sustainability:

Innovation and R&D

Developing state-of-the-art orthopedic surgical equipment hinges on continuous research and innovation. This includes:

  • Investing in New Technologies: Robotics, AI, and biomaterials are transforming surgical instrumentation and implants.
  • Enhancing Product Efficacy and Safety: Rigorous testing and clinical trials to meet regulatory standards and improve patient outcomes.
  • Custom Solutions: Personalized implants and modular systems that cater to individual patient anatomy and needs.

Regulatory Compliance and Certification

Regulations such as the FDA (Food and Drug Administration) in the U.S. and CE marking in Europe ensure that orthopedic surgical equipment products meet safety and quality standards. Staying compliant not only facilitates market entry but also builds trust with healthcare providers.

Quality Assurance and Manufacturing Excellence

High-quality manufacturing processes, including ISO certification, Six Sigma practices, and lean production, are vital. They reduce costs, improve product reliability, and bolster brand reputation.

Strong Distribution and Supply Chain Networks

Efficient logistics and a robust supply chain ensure timely delivery, especially in emergency surgical settings. Building partnerships with distributors and healthcare institutions locally and globally is crucial for expanding market reach.

Effective Marketing and Brand Positioning

Clear branding emphasizing innovation, safety, and clinical efficacy attracts the attention of surgeons, hospital administrators, and procurement entities. Educational content, participating in medical conferences, and showcasing clinical data enhance credibility.

Emerging Trends and Future Outlook in Orthopedic Surgical Equipment

Integration of Digital Technologies

From AI-driven surgical planning to augmented reality overlays during procedures—digital tools are revolutionizing orthopedic surgeries. Businesses investing in these advances are poised for leadership.

Personalized and Regenerative Treatments

3D-printed custom implants and tissue engineering are making personalized treatment an achievable reality, offering superior functional outcomes.

Focus on Sustainability and Eco-Friendly Manufacturing

Eco-conscious practices, biodegradable materials, and waste reduction in manufacturing resonate with modern corporate social responsibility initiatives.

Regulatory Evolution and Market Access

Regulatory landscapes are tightening but also opening new pathways for innovative devices through accelerated approval programs—businesses prepared with rigorous data will benefit most.
